CD ROM DRIVE wont read some CD rom

I am fixing a PC for a friend. The CD ROM drive on an old gateway will not read some type of CD but will read others. I put in a CD-R data CD recorded with Adaptec it works fine. But when I put other CD like kids game or music CD it wont. Is this a formatting issue, CD-RW issue or What. I even chage out the drive with an older drive it does the same. please help. Is there a reader or something I could install to solve this?

A lot of the older computers can't read CD-RWs, but can read very basic CD-Rs. My old gateway can't read anything but CD-Rs. I think it has to be a multiread drive, which is newer, to read other formats.

I don't think there's a problem with the CD themselves unless they are scraped or damaged in any way. I wager it's the drive itself. Just how auld is this puter and what is the speed of the CD-ROM drive?

My auld 6X CD-ROM couldn't read certain CD-Rs and it announced its imminent death when it also stopped reading some original CDs.
